[發明專利]一種反池化運算方法和電路有效
| 申請號: | 201910690114.6 | 申請日: | 2019-07-29 |
| 公開(公告)號: | CN110489819B | 公開(公告)日: | 2022-11-18 |
| 發明(設計)人: | 廖裕民;盧捷 | 申請(專利權)人: | 瑞芯微電子股份有限公司 |
| 主分類號: | G06F30/30 | 分類號: | G06F30/30;G06N3/04 |
| 代理公司: | 福州市景弘專利代理事務所(普通合伙) 35219 | 代理人: | 郭鵬飛;徐劍兵 |
| 地址: | 350003 福建省*** | 國省代碼: | 福建;35 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 反池化 運算 方法 電路 | ||
本發明提供了一種反池化運算方法和電路,所述方法包括以下步驟:取數控制單元從數據緩存單元中獲取至少一個有效值以及有效值對應的坐標值,并將獲取的有效值存儲于有效值緩存單元,將有效值對應的坐標值存儲于坐標值緩存單元中;池化還原單元根據獲取的各有效值和各有效值對應的坐標位置還原出池化塊;有效點判斷單元根據池化窗的大小和步進值判斷當前池化窗內包含的各數值是否為有效點,若是則還原寫控制單元將有效點數值寫入還原緩存單元;還原讀控制單元讀取還原緩存單元中的有效點,并通過總線回寫單元將讀取的有效值回寫至數據緩存單元中。本發明的反池化運算電路邏輯清晰,易于控制,可以高效實現反池化運算操作。
技術領域
本發明涉及芯片電路設計領域,特別涉及一種反池化運算方法和電路。
背景技術
隨著人工智能深度學習神經網絡的快速發展,人們對人工智能應用的需求越來越強烈。由于深度學習神經網絡自身的特性對硬件資源的要求較高,在運行時將產生巨大的功耗,導致電子設備續航能力差、功耗大等問題。而反池化技術是神經網絡運算過程中最重要的計算之一,目前的神經網絡加速電路往往將反池化運算交給CPU或者GPU等通用計算單元進行,由于其計算量巨大且控制復雜,造成池化運算往往成為整體神經網絡運算的瓶頸。
發明內容
為此,需要提供一種反池化運算的技術方案,用以解決反池化運算計算量大、控制復雜,導致在運行過程中功耗大的問題。
為實現上述目的,發明人提供了一種反池化運算電路,所述電路包括取數控制單元、有效值緩存單元、坐標值緩存單元、池化還原單元、有效點判斷單元、還原寫控制單元、還原緩存單元、還原讀控制單元、總線回寫單元;
所述取數控制單元分別與有效值緩存單元、坐標值緩存單元連接,所述池化還原單元還分別與有效值緩存單元、坐標值緩存單元連接,所述池化還原單元與有效點判斷單元連接,所述有效點判斷單元與還原寫控制單元連接,所述還原寫控制單元與還原緩存單元連接,所述還原緩存單元與還原讀控制單元連接,所述還原讀控制單元與總線回寫單元連接;
所述取數控制單元用于從數據緩存單元中獲取至少一個有效值以及有效值對應的坐標值,并將獲取的有效值存儲于有效值緩存單元,將有效值對應的坐標值存儲于坐標值緩存單元中;
所述池化還原單元用于根據獲取的各有效值和各有效值對應的坐標位置還原出池化塊;所述池化塊包括若干池化窗,每一池化窗根據一有效值及該有效值對應的坐標位置進行還原;
所述有效點判斷單元用于根據池化窗的大小和步進值判斷當前池化窗內包含的各數值是否為有效點,若是則還原寫控制單元將有效點數值寫入還原緩存單元;
所述還原讀控制單元用于讀取還原緩存單元中的有效點,并通過總線回寫單元將讀取的有效值回寫至數據緩存單元中。
進一步地,所述還原緩存單元包括多個緩存器組,每一緩存器組包括多個緩存器,每一緩存器用于存儲一有效點數值;“還原寫控制單元將有效點數值寫入還原緩存單元”包括:
還原寫控制單元以池化窗為單位依次將當前池化窗內的有效點數值寫入對應的緩存器組中。
進一步地,每一緩存器組所包含的緩存器數量為池化窗大小尺寸數值。
進一步地,所述還原讀控制單元根據各個有效點在池化塊上的坐標順序,基于所述池化塊的行或列排序來讀取所述緩存器組中的有效點數值。
進一步地,”池化還原單元用于根據獲取的各有效值和各有效值對應的坐標位置還原出池化塊”包括:
池化還原單元根據一有效值和該有效值對應的坐標位置,將該有效值填充至池化窗中的對應位置,并根據預設池化規則將與該有效值相對應的數值填充至池化窗中除該有效值外的其他位置;執行上述操作,直至所有有效值對應的池化窗都還原完成,得到池化塊。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于瑞芯微電子股份有限公司,未經瑞芯微電子股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201910690114.6/2.html,轉載請聲明來源鉆瓜專利網。





